Building a Climate Progress Thermometer

For a climate-focused event at Redeemer Community Church, I was asked to create a large visual centerpiece that could help communicate a hopeful message about climate action.

After kicking around a few ideas, we landed on a giant thermometer.

The basic idea was simple: as communities adopt cleaner technologies and practices, carbon emissions go down. So unlike a traditional thermometer where the liquid rises, this one was designed to show progress by moving downward.

Design

The project started with a few rough sketches and eventually made its way into Figma.

I wanted the piece to be large enough to be seen from across the room, but also simple enough that someone could understand it within a few seconds.

The final design included:

  • A large thermometer graphic
  • “Climate Progress” lettering
  • A movable indicator
  • The phrase “A Cleaner Creation is Possible”

The overall size ended up being about four feet tall and two feet wide.

CNC Fabrication

One of my goals for this project was to continue getting more comfortable with CNC fabrication.

The lettering and various graphic elements were exported and prepared for cutting on my CNC router. Most of the components were cut from 1/4″ MDF and then assembled into the final display.

There is always a little bit of a learning curve with projects like this. Toolpaths need adjusting, tabs need tweaking, and sometimes materials decide to fight back.

In this case, some of the MDF sheets arrived damaged and needed repair before they could be used. A combination of patches, filler, sanding, primer, and paint eventually got everything looking the way I wanted.

Assembly

Once all the parts were cut, the project became a giant puzzle.

The individual components were painted, assembled, and mounted to a backing panel. A custom easel supported the finished piece during the event.

Tools & Materials

  • Figma
  • Fusion 360
  • Easel
  • CNC Router
  • MDF
  • Primer and Paint
  • Assorted Sanding Supplies
